1616 AN ACT concerning 1
1717
1818 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le Trail Fund and Off–Highway Recreational 2
1919 Vehicle Recreation Oversight Board – Alterations and Establishment 3
2020
2121 FOR the purpose of altering the contents and authorized uses of the Off–Highway 4
2222 Recreational Vehicle Trail Fund; establishing the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le 5
2323 Recreation Oversight Board to advise the Secretary of Natural Resources on certain 6
2424 matters and review and approve certain expenditures; altering the percentages of 7
2525 the revenue from a certain excise tax the Comptroller is required to distribute to the 8
2626 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le Trail Fund in certain fiscal years; and generally 9
2727 relating to the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le Trail Fund and the Off–Highway 10
2828 Recreational Vehicle Recreation Oversight Board. 11

7373 5–1011. 17
7474
7575 (a) In this section, “Fund” means the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le Trail 18
7676 Fund. 19
7777
7878 (b) There is an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le Trail Fund. 20
7979
8080 (c) The purpose of the Fund is to maintain and construct trails for off–highway 21
8181 recreational vehicles. 22
8282
8383 (d) The Secretary shall administer the Fund. 23
8484
8585 (e) (1) The Fund is a special, nonlapsing fund that is not subject to § 7–302 of 24
8686 the State Finance and Procurement Article. 25
8787
8888 (2) The State Treasurer shall hold the Fund separately, and the 26
8989 Comptroller shall account for the Fund. 27
9090
9191 (f) The Fund consists of: 28
9292
9393 (1) Revenue distributed to the Fund under § 13 –814(b) of the 29
9494 Transportation Article; 30
9595
9696 (2) Money appropriated in the State budget for the Fund; 31 SENATE BILL 857 3
9797
9898
9999
100100 (3) MONEY GENERATED FROM OFF–ROAD VEHICLE REGISTRATIONS 1
101101 UNDER § 5–209 OF THIS TITLE; and 2
102102
103103 [(3)] (4) Any other money from any other source accepted for the benefit 3
104104 of the Fund. 4
105105
106106 (g) [The] SUBJECT TO § 5–1011.1(I) OF THIS SUBTITLE , THE Fund may be 5
107107 used only to: 6
108108
109109 (1) Maintain trails for off–highway recreational vehicles on State park land 7
110110 that was purchased or leased by the Department before January 1, [2017] 2024; 8
111111
112112 (2) Maintain and construct trails for off–highway recreational vehicles on 9
113113 State park land that is purchased or leased by the Department on or after January 1, [2017] 10
114114 2024; [and] 11
115115
116116 (3) Maintain and construct trails for off–highway recreational vehicles on 12
117117 any land that is not State park land that is purchased or leased by the Department; AND 13
118118
119119 (4) MAINTAIN THE O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E 14
120120 RECREATION OVERSIGHT BOARD ESTABLISHED UND ER § 5–1011.1 OF THIS 15
121121 SUBTITLE. 16
122122
123123 (h) (1) The State Treasurer shall invest the money of the Fund in the same 17
124124 manner as other State money may be invested. 18
125125
126126 (2) Any interest earnings of the Fund shall be credited to the General Fund 19
127127 of the State. 20
128128
129129 (i) Expenditures from the Fund may be made only in accordance with the State 21
130130 budget. 22
131131
132132 (j) Money expended from the Fund for maintaining and constructing trails for 23
133133 off–highway recreational vehicles is supplemental to and is not intended to take the place 24
134134 of funding that otherwise would be appropriated for maintaining and constructing trails 25
135135 for off–highway recreational vehicles. 26
136136
137137 (K) ON OR BEFORE DECEMBER 31 EACH YEAR, BEGINNING IN 2024, THE 27
138138 SECRETARY SHALL PUBLI SH ON THE DEPARTMENT ’S WEBSITE A REPORT 28
139139 DETAILING THE USE OF THE FUND. 29

141141 5–1011.1. 30
142142 4 SENATE BILL 857
143143
144144
145145 (A) (1) IN THIS SECTION THE F OLLOWING WORD S HAVE THE MEANINGS 1
146146 INDICATED. 2
147147
148148 (2) “BOARD” MEANS THE O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E 3
149149 RECREATION OVERSIGHT BOARD. 4
150150
151151 (3) “FUND” MEANS THE O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E 5
152152 TRAIL FUND ESTABLISHED UNDE R § 5–1011 OF THIS SUBTITLE. 6
153153
154154 (B) THERE IS AN O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E RECREATION 7
155155 OVERSIGHT BOARD. 8
156156
157157 (C) (1) THE BOARD CONSISTS OF THE FO LLOWING MEMBERS , 9
158158 APPOINTED BY THE GOVERNOR: 10
159159
160160 (I) ONE REPRESENTATIVE OF THE MARYLAND OFF–HIGHWAY 11
161161 VEHICLE ALLIANCE; 12
162162
163163 (II) ONE REPRESENTATIVE OF THE MARYLAND MOTORCYCLE 13
164164 DEALERS ASSOCIATION; 14
165165
166166 (III) ONE REPRESENTATIVE OF THE AMERICAN MOTORCYCLIST 15
167167 ASSOCIATION DISTRICT 7; 16
168168
169169 (IV) ONE INDIVIDUAL REPRESENTING ALL–TERRAIN VEHICLE , 17
170170 UTILITY TERRAIN VEHI CLE, OR SIDE–BY–SIDE VEHICLE DRIVERS; AND 18
171171
172172 (V) ONE INDIVIDUAL REPRES ENTING ON – AND OFF–ROAD 19
173173 MOTOR VEHICLE DRIVER S. 20
174174
175175 (2) EACH MEMBER SHALL BE A RESIDENT OF THE STATE. 21
176176
177177 (D) FROM AMONG ITS MEMBER S, THE BOARD SHALL ELECT A C HAIR EACH 22
178178 YEAR. 23
179179
180180 (E) (1) THE TERM OF A MEMBER IS 4 YEARS. 24
181181
182182 (2) THE TERM O F A MEMBER IS STAGGE RED AS REQUIRED BY T HE 25
183183 TERMS PROVIDED FOR M EMBERS OF THE BOARD ON OCTOBER 1, 2024. 26
184184
185185 (3) AT THE END OF A TERM , A MEMBER CONTINUES T O SERVE UNTIL 27
186186 A SUCCESSOR IS APPOI NTED AND QUALIFIES . 28
187187 SENATE BILL 857 5
188188
189189
190190 (4) A MEMBER WHO IS APPOIN TED AFTER A TERM HAS BEGUN SERVES 1
191191 ONLY FOR THE REST OF THE TERM AND UNTIL A SUCCESSOR IS APPOINT ED AND 2
192192 QUALIFIES. 3
193193
194194 (5) IF A VACANCY OCCURS A MONG THE MEMBERS , THE GOVERNOR 4
195195 SHALL PROMPTLY APPOI NT A SUCCESSOR WHO S HALL SERVE UNTIL THE TERM 5
196196 EXPIRES. 6
197197
198198 (F) (1) THE DEPARTMENT SH ALL PROVIDE STAFF FO R THE BOARD. 7
199199
200200 (2) ADDITIONAL SUPPORT FO R THE BOARD SHALL BE PROVID ED BY: 8
201201
202202 (I) THE SECRETARY, OR THE SECRETARY’S DESIGNEE; 9
203203
204204 (II) THE MARYLAND PARK SERVICE; 10
205205
206206 (III) THE FOREST SERVICE; 11
207207
208208 (IV) THE WILDLIFE AND HERITAGE SERVICE; AND 12
209209
210210 (V) ONE REPRESENTATIVE OF EACH COUNTY IN WHICH AN 13
211211 O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E TRAIL MAINTA INED BY THE DEPARTMENT 14
212212 IS LOCATED, DESIGNATED BY THE DEPARTMENT . 15
213213
214214 (G) THE BOARD SHALL MEET AT LEAST QUARTERLY . 16
215215
216216 (H) THE BOARD SHALL: 17
217217
218218 (1) ADVISE THE SECRETARY ON THE OPER ATION, ACQUISITION, 18
219219 REGULATION , AND GENERAL OVERSIGH T OF OFF –H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L 19
220220 VEHICLE TRAILS AND R ECREATION IN THE STATE; AND 20
221221
222222 (2) REVIEW AND APPROVE EX PENDITURES FROM THE FUND IN 21
223223 ACCORDANCE WITH SUBS ECTION (I) OF THIS SECTION. 22
224224
225225 (I) AN EXPENDITURE FROM T HE FUND SHALL BE REVIEWED AN D 23
226226 APPROVED BY THE BOARD IN ACCORDANCE W ITH THE FOLLOWING RE QUIREMENTS : 24
227227
228228 (1) AT LEAST 25% OF THE ANNUAL FUND BALANCE SHALL BE USED 25
229229 FOR TRAIL DEVELOPMEN T; 26
230230
231231 (2) AT LEAST 10% OF THE ANNUAL FUND BALANCE SHALL BE USED 27
232232 FOR O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E TRAIL MAINTENANCE ; 28 6 SENATE BILL 857
233233
234234
235235
236236 (3) AT LEAST 10% OF THE ANNUAL FUND BALANCE SHALL BE USED 1
237237 FOR THE DEVELOPMENT OR MAINTENANCE OF CA MPING SITES, PARKING, OR OTHER 2
238238 INFRASTRUCTURE NECES SARY TO SUPPORT OFF –H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L 3
239239 VEHICLE RIDERS AND R ECREATIONAL ACTIVITI ES ON LANDS MANAGED PRIMARILY 4
240240 FOR O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IONAL VEHICLE USE; 5
241241
242242 (4) AT LEAST 5% OF THE ANNUAL FUND BALANCE SHALL BE USED TO 6
243243 LEASE LANDS FOR PUBL IC OFF–HIGHWAY RECREATIO NAL VEHICLE USE ; 7
244244
245245 (5) AT LEAST 10% OF THE ANNUAL FUND BALANCE SHALL BE 8
246246 AUTHORIZED TO ADVERT ISE, PROMOTE, AND MARKET OFF –HIGHWAY 9
247247 RECREATIONAL VEHICLE USE AND EDUCATION IN THE STATE; AND 10
248248
249249 (6) FUNDS FROM THE FUND SHALL BE USED TO COVER THE 11
250250 ADMINISTRATIVE AND OPERATING COSTS OF T HE BOARD IN AN AMOUNT 12
251251 DETERMINED NECESSARY BY THE BOARD. 13

253253 Article – Transportation 14
254254
255255 13–814. 15
256256
257257 (a) Except as provided in subsection (b) of this section, money collected under this 16
258258 part shall be deposited in the State Treasury and accounted for on the records of the 17
259259 Comptroller and transferred to the Transportation Trust Fund. 18
260260
261261 (b) Of the revenue from the excise tax imposed for each certificate of title issued 19
262262 for an off–highway recreational vehicle under § 13–809 of this subtitle, the Comptroller 20
263263 shall distribute to the Off–Highway Recreational Vehicle Trail Fund established under § 21
264264 5–1011 of the Natural Resources Article: 22
265265
266266 (1) [25%] 75% in fiscal year [2019] 2026; and 23
267267
268268 (2) [50%] 95% in fiscal year [2020] 2027 and each year thereafter. 24
